Output ead3fadf6add4422aa7c0d714faebbee4897b60ef9927fde9a87fdffb505fe67:0

value
20327023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 737ced69750f7f726efe2f69fa633b261411adc4 OP_EQUAL
address
3CDfHiDmiN1nKwVrbc8YQjAF8eE3ZXzfNG
transaction
ead3fadf6add4422aa7c0d714faebbee4897b60ef9927fde9a87fdffb505fe67
confirmations
197261
spent
true